Distribution of pressure on the breast in mammography using flexible and rigid compression plates: implications on patient handling.

Abstract

BACKGROUND

Breast compression in mammography is important but is a source of discomfort and has been linked to screening non-attendance. Reducing compression has little effect on breast thickness, and likely little effect on image quality, due to force being absorbed in the stiff juxta thoracic area instead of in the central breast.

PURPOSE

To investigate whether a flexible compression plate can redistribute force to the central breast and whether this affects perceived pain.

MATERIAL AND METHODS

Twenty-eight women recalled from mammography screening were compressed with flexible and rigid plates while retaining force and positioning, 15 in the craniocaudal (CC) view and 13 in the mediolateral oblique (MLO) view. Pressure distribution was continuously measured using pressure sensors.

RESULTS

The flexible plate showed greater mean breast pressure in both views: 2.8 versus 2.3 kPa for CC (confidence interval [CI] = 0.2-0.8) and 1.0 versus 0.5 kPa for MLO (CI = 0.2-0.6). The percentage of applied force distributed to the breast was significantly higher with the flexible plate, both on CC (36% vs. 22%, CI = 1-11) and MLO (30% vs. 14%, CI = 4-13).

CONCLUSION

The flexible plate redistributes pressure to the central breast, achieving a better compression, particularly in the MLO view, though much applied force is still applied to the juxta thoracic region.

摘要

背景

乳腺摄影中的乳房压迫很重要,但会引起不适,并与筛查不参加有关。由于力被吸收在胸壁的僵硬区域而不是中央乳房,因此减少压迫对乳房厚度几乎没有影响,并且可能对图像质量几乎没有影响。

目的

研究柔性压迫板是否可以将力重新分配到中央乳房,以及这是否会影响感知到的疼痛。

材料和方法

从乳房 X 光筛查中召回了 28 名女性,同时保留力和位置,分别在头尾位(CC)视图和内外斜位(MLO)视图中用柔性和刚性板进行压缩。使用压力传感器连续测量压力分布。

结果

在两种视图中,柔性板显示出更高的平均乳房压力:CC 为 2.8 对 2.3 kPa(置信区间 [CI] = 0.2-0.8),MLO 为 1.0 对 0.5 kPa(CI = 0.2-0.6)。柔性板在 CC(36%对 22%,CI = 1-11)和 MLO(30%对 14%,CI = 4-13)上,应用力分布到乳房的百分比显著更高。

结论

柔性板将压力重新分配到中央乳房,实现了更好的压缩,特别是在 MLO 视图中,尽管仍然有很大的力施加在胸壁区域。
